OK. As someone said earlier. MTV does Artist of The Week spots featuring any number of musical artists. The only real reason you see the Cloverfield spots like that is basically MTV's way of showing you two commercials at once.
It's not really anything special, like a hacked broadcast or something. Just the fact that being a Paramount spot it's virtually free air time, so may as well give out two company messages at once.
The last three weeks Flyleaf, Cobra Starship, and this week it's Kate Nash.
By the way Viva La Cobra is the name of Cobra Starship's album, and just a spoofed bit on MTV. Kinda making fun of Real World.
I've been watching the Cloverfield spots since they've begun on MTV and VH1. For a while there there were spots every other break. In prime time they've gotten lots of play. So thankfully they are trying.
